Output 5cc3131abf5e4401c29e978aad08bfb6f6fb5fc1df7dba1f227c4559029e5054:3

value
296724000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e64e2b6f21818a3378bee397829471f92e8e07c2 OP_EQUAL
address
MUtuHsgi6LM9eR8bNhpoZmhvs3USTNDDXz
transaction
5cc3131abf5e4401c29e978aad08bfb6f6fb5fc1df7dba1f227c4559029e5054
spent
true